Our final stop was San Diego home of the most awesome (so says me) fish tacos! This is the World Famous Fish Taco plate from Rubio's Fresh Mexican Grill. Rubio's is credited with introducing fish tacos to Southern California and starting a phenomenon that has spread coast to coast. The fish is beer batter dipped and fried, wrapped in a warm corn tortilla and topped with crisp cabbage. It is just delicious.
